Latest Patents: Among his most recent patents, Broaddus has developed techniques for "Reporting hazardous condition using a mobile device." This patent outlines a method where a mobile device captures sensor data to determine environmental hazards. Should the environment not satisfy a predetermined hazard criteria, the device suppresses data transmission. However, once hazards are detected, it transmits relevant sensor data to ensure user safety.

Another notable patent is titled "Efficient augmented reality display calibration." This innovative method involves calibrating multiple camera systems within head-mounted display devices to enhance the performance of augmented reality applications. By integrating various calibration parameters, Broaddus’s invention optimizes the interaction between visual inputs and the digital overlay, thereby improving the overall user experience.
